Sachem North ready for Euro Challenge

Sachem North’s Euro Challenge team held two rehearsal sessions at the high school on Thursday in preparation for its preliminary round of the Euro Challenge Championships in New York City later this month.

The Euro Challenge is a program launched by the Delegation of the European Union in the United States in partnership with The Moody’s Foundation and with the Federal Reserve Bank of New York serving as program advisor.

The program is supported by BNP Paribas, Credit Suisse, and major universities. This competition has been an exciting educational opportunity for our students as they have learned an extraordinary amount on the European economy and the single currency, the euro.

Our team’s challenge has been to solve Italy’s high unemployment problem and after thorough research and analysis, our team is ready to present their suggestions for policy change.
